Yeah. I don't want to speak in terms of conflict of interest, as the more this league progresses, the closer my team is to just winning the money, but both teams we've played so far (despite only 2 players being there this week) have been pretty damn manner, something I'm not used to. It's been very fun so far.

As far as league issues, I'm gonna go with minimal. The largest issues are the lack of leadership per team. I don't understand how people can sign up for a league, then once dispersed into teams expect the organizer to individually PM like 100 people when it's their responsibility as a player of the league to check the thread. In other words, if you drive with a blindfold on, you can't blame the guy who is inevitably going to hit you. I fail to believe that with how the teams are laid out that there is the inability to compete relatively well, teams just need leadership.

Suggestion:
Every team should have a designated leader, if you request one, one will appear. Generally, the higher level the player, the more responsible leader they'll be. It also helps that they have more of an understanding of the game, and can better lay out practice fundamentals and proper lineups.

Next, every player download Skype and check it twice daily like an e-mail. With that, make a Skype group per team with every player in it. Wallah, mission accomplished.

tl;dr
Stop crying if you're on a team having trouble, it's no ones fault except your own. If you don't try, you'll never succeed.

Edit:
There are enough rules. As with my comment regarding leadership being more sensible with higher level gamers (tier 1 and 2), they have more experience in well run leagues. They understand basic clan war rules, and can problem solve without too much drama. Simply use common sense and ask team members of higher caliber than yourselves (aimed towards lower tiers - which seem to be the ones acting childish thus far) for things that aren't as clear to you.
